AquaLogic Data Services Studio is the basis of the ALDSP IDE. The Studio run inside the Eclipse framework.
Artifact | Purpose |
---|---|
Project Explorer | Contains project artifacts including data services and their functions. |
Properties editor |
Contains read/write and read only properties associated with the selected artifact. For example a function may be set to public, protected, or private through its Properties editor. |
Outline manager |
Provides a scrollable view of your model, query, or update mapper. This is particularly useful in large projects since the work area may not be large enough to show all the artifacts. |
Console |
The console appears whenever the server is accessed. |
Servers tab |
Display the status of the ALDSP server which in turn provides clients with access to data services and their underlying data sources. |
Problems tab | Displays problems encountered by the project. |
Error Log tab |
Displays errors associated with the project. |
The Windows > Show View menu option can be used to add additional windows to the perspective.
In addition, several ALDSP Perspective menu options are provided under:
File > New
These allow you to, first, create an ALDSP dataspace project and then to add various types of data services, models and web service mapper.
